Toano Students Recognized for Diverse Works of Art
There were 51 entries from Toano Middle School students to the PTA’s Reflections Contest, reported organizer Ms. Mattie Coven, a parent volunteer. This year’s theme was “Diversity is…” Students were urged to dig deep into their creative self and to share works of art, literature, dance and music based upon their interpretation of the theme. High honors went to three Toano Middle School students who excelled at the imaginative challenge presented to them.
Charlotte Apperson received an Award of Excellence in Photography
Nina Jones received an Award of Merit in Visual Arts
Samantha Snyder received an Award of Merit in Literature

School Hours: School officially begins at 7:20 AM and ends at 2:20 PM. Students should report directly to homeroom. Please do not drop your child off before 7:10 AM, since there will be no adult supervision until 7:10 AM. If students arrive late to school, they must report to the main office to obtain a pass to class
